About This Book

The sweet scent of blooming flowers fills the air, and soft petals brush against Bella and Rosie's cheeks as they explore the bright spring garden. Every buzzing bee and chirping bird invites them to discover new wonders. Their hearts flutter with joy, soaking in the magic of the season's fresh beginnings.

Quick Assessment

This gentle story celebrates the arrival of spring through the eyes of two friends, Bella and Rosie, as they experience the season's sights, sounds, and smells. Designed for early readers ages 5 to 8, it uses simple language to engage young children with themes of nature and friendship. The book is free of any intense content and is ideal for introducing seasonal changes in an accessible way.

Why we rated Bella and Rosie Love Spring 7C

Bella and Rosie Love Spring is written at a Level 2 reading level across 12 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 3.0 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Bella and Rosie Love Spring works for readers up to grade 4.0.

We rate Bella and Rosie Love Spring as 7C ("Clear")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.

No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.

Thematically, Bella and Rosie Love Spring explores friendship, science & nature, and family —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
